Home Foundation Leveling in Bloomfield Hills, MI
Home foundation leveling services are designed to address uneven or settling foundations that can affect the stability and safety of a property. These services typically involve assessing the foundation’s condition, identifying areas of subsidence or shifting, and implementing solutions such as underpinning or piering to restore the foundation to a level position. Projects often include leveling concrete slabs, basement floors, or entire foundation structures, helping to prevent further damage and maintain the integrity of the building.
Property owners considering foundation leveling usually want to understand the signs of foundation issues, such as cracks in walls, uneven floors, or sticking doors and windows. It’s also important to know the scope of work required, potential causes of settling, and how the process can help protect the property’s value and safety. Proper evaluation and timely intervention can minimize future repairs and ensure the long-term stability of the home.

Common Home Foundation Leveling Jobs
Foundation Repair - addresses uneven or settling foundations to improve stability.
Basement Leveling - corrects uneven basement floors caused by shifting soil or moisture issues.
Slab Jacking - raises sunken concrete slabs to restore proper surface level.
Pier and Beam Leveling - stabilizes and levels homes built on pier and beam foundations.
Crack Repair - seals foundation cracks to prevent further movement and structural damage.
Settlement Correction - stabilizes shifting soil to prevent future foundation movement.
Home Foundation Leveling Questions
What causes uneven foundation settling? Soil movement, moisture changes, and poor drainage can lead to uneven settling of a home’s foundation.
How can foundation leveling improve a property? It stabilizes the structure, reduces further damage, and helps maintain proper alignment of floors and walls.
What signs indicate a need for foundation leveling? Cracks in walls or floors, sticking doors or windows, and uneven flooring are common indicators.
Is foundation leveling suitable for all types of homes? It is typically effective for most residential foundations experiencing unevenness or minor shifting.
